Atew store under construction
Zeb's Zip In on Interstate 75 and Highway 41 South has been demolished to make
way for a new convenience store and gas station. Construction workers say the
new, larger store should be completed in late June.

Fender bender
When Grady Donald Shirley Jr. tried to drive his 1984
Dodge across the ballfleld at Perry High School
Tuesday he had a few problems. According to police
reports Shirley was traveling 35 mph and skidded when
he applied his brakes. There was extensive damage to
the left front fender of Shirley's car.
